I have an 11" surface cleaner. Th e only problem with doing steps is that it does not get close enough to the edges. Still have to go back with the wand.

By the time it takes to do the steps with the cleaner. go back and cut the corners with the wand, and then rinse. You are faster by just using the wand. End result either way seems to clean the same.
